UK VISA REFUSED?
You may have MORE options than you think.

Every year, thousands of people in the UK have visa applications refused by the Home Office. Many assume that's the end. It isn't.

Here's what your refusal letter might not tell you…

DEPENDING ON YOUR VISA TYPE, YOU MAY BE ABLE TO:

βš–οΈ Appeal to the First-tier Tribunal (Immigration & Asylum Chamber)
πŸ“‹ Request an Administrative Review of the decision
πŸ“ Submit a fresh application with stronger evidence
πŸ›‘ Raise human rights grounds if removal would breach your rights
πŸ”Ž Apply for Judicial Review if the decision was legally flawed

THE MOST IMPORTANT THING: DEADLINES ARE TIGHT.

You often have only 14 or 28 days from your refusal to lodge an appeal. Miss that window β€” and your options shrink dramatically.

Some common visa types and your options at a glance:

🏠 Spouse / Family visa refusal β†’ Right of appeal (in most cases)
πŸŽ“ Student visa refusal β†’ Administrative review (14-day deadline)
🌍 Asylum refusal β†’ Right of appeal
πŸ‡ͺπŸ‡Ί EU Settlement Scheme refusal β†’ Right of appeal
✈️ Visitor visa refusal β†’ Fresh application or Judicial Review

Most people in Glasgow have NO idea they’re entitled to FREE legal help.
If you’re facing a legal problem β€” housing, immigration, family, benefits, a debt, an injury β€” you may not have to face it alone. Or pay a penny.
Here’s what most Glasgow residents don’t know about Legal Aid in Scotland…
――――――――――――――――――――――
βœ… WHO MAY QUALIFY:
βœ… Anyone earning under approx. Β£26,239 / year (after tax)
βœ… Universal Credit / Housing Benefit claimants (often automatic)
βœ… Anyone facing eviction or housing problems
βœ… Immigration or asylum applicants
βœ… Anyone with a family law or child welfare issue
βœ… People appealing a benefits decision (PIP, Universal Credit, etc.)
